Recipe: Caesar Salad Dressing - From Scratch!


Caesar salad - it's complex flavours and textures are so addictive, and made from such interesting ingredients.  Most people don't even know that there's anchovies are in there, or at least are supposed to be!  This is a  really easy dressing to make, and is so simple yet satisfying.  Store in a jar and it will last in your fridge for a week.  That's if you don't finish it all first....


Makes  about 2 cups

Ingredients:
-1 egg yolk*
-3 tbsp fresh lemon juice
-1 tsp minced garlic (about 1 small clove.  If you like it extra garlicky, feel free to add more)
-1/2 tsp Worcestershire sauce
-1/4 tsp red pepper flakes
-1 tbsp Dijon mustard
-2 anchovy fillets, finely minced and mashed
-1/3 cup extra-virgin olive oil
-3/4 cup vegetable oil

-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

  • In a medium bowl, whisk together the egg yolk, lemon juice, garlic, Worcestershire, pepper flakes, mustard, and anchovies. Slowly whisk in the oils to emulsify. Season, to taste, with salt and pepper.
  • Toss with clean, dry, chopped romaine lettuce, with cooked bacon, croutons, and freshly grated Parmesan cheese.


*RAW EGG WARNING :
Raw eggs, like raw meat or dairy, poses a slight risk of salmonella or other food-borne illness. To reduce this risk, use only fresh, properly refrigerated, clean grade A or AA eggs with intact shells, and avoid contact between the yolks or whites and the shell.
